On the 16th October 2015. I visited North Tyneside general hospital with my 10 year old daughter who had unfortunately broken her foot, as you can imagine she was very distressed and in a lot of pain, I drove her straight to the hospital with my other 2 young children in tow and left the house without my purse or phone, I only realised when I got there that I had no money on me for the parking machine and mentioned this to the staff, I was assured that I could just ring up the following day and pay for an hours parking that way, as I was leaving the car park I noticed a camera pointing at the number plates of cars could you please tell me how or who I need to contact to pay for our parking as I would hate to be left with a large parking fine for something that was a total mistake at a stressful time. Thank you.
